FenceGuard: Modular DIY Cat-Proofing Enclosure Kit

Commercial catios and professional roller fences cost thousands of dollars, forcing low-budget cat owners to let pets roam where they face extreme risks of injury, ballooning vet bills ($800+ per trip), and hostility from neighbors.

EXISTING SOLUTION GAPS

Containment options like cat catios and cat roller fences are too expensive for budget-constrained owners.
Over-the-counter pet antiseptics fail against deep projectile puncture wounds, leading to rapid infection and vet visits.
Standard yard surveillance is difficult to set up or position to catch specific off-property animal abuse incidents.
Collars with cameras or trackable accessories are ineffective because cats refuse to wear or keep collars on.

RISKS & ASSUMPTIONS

Top Risks

High product return rates from improper installation

If non-technical owners install the brackets loosely, agile cats may escape, leading to negative reviews and returns.

SEV 4
Pushback from strict indoor-only pet advocacy groups

Online communities frequently advocate 100% indoor containment, potentially generating friction in organic marketing channels.

SEV 3
Supply chain and shipping cost spikes

Physical goods require hardware sourcing and dimensional weight packaging, which can squeeze initial margins.
